Difference is the colour of the screen and the later VFDs are supposedly easier to read. I have no probs at all with glare on mine even in full sun/daylight. Check with danny for the LCD

If your going to pod mount it you may have problems with the bright sun light, it makes it imposible to read the screen, this isn't a major problem as your always moving but can be a little anyoing, If your going for single din down by the stereo you shold be okay using a LCD
